Pharmacy Tech Degree Programs
A pharmacy technician diploma or certificate program can be completed in one year or less and provides the basic education and training needed to sit for the Certified Pharmacy Technician exam. These programs introduce students to basic concepts in pharmaceutical technology, record keeping, pharmacy law and ethics, and pharmacology. They typically include a combination of classroom learning and lab training so that students learn how to dispense medication, prepare sterile products, and manage prescription orders. Students interested in a more comprehensive educational experience can enroll in a pharmacy technician associate degree program. Although a degree is not required to apply for entry-level positions, some students choose to pursue an Associate of Applied Science degree so they can advance in their careers and apply for jobs as a compounding lab technician, pharmacy service technician, pharmacy implementation specialist or similar roles. Earning an associate degree can also help a student prepare for a Bachelor of Pharmacy or a bachelor’s degree in a related field.

Is the Pharmacy Tech College Accredited? Many pharmacist tech programs and vocational schools have acquired a national or regional accreditation. One of the most highly regarded accrediting agencies is the American Society of Health-System Pharmacists (ASHP). Colleges earning accreditation from the ASHP have been screened and certified to offer a complete superior education. Online programs may also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which deals only with distance or online learning. Make sure to confirm that the certificate or degree program in addition to the school you choose are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ting agency. Along with helping guarantee that you obtain a quality education, it might assist in getting financial aid or student loans, which are often not accessible for non-accredited schools. Also, certification may mandate that the program of training is accredited. And a number of Fairhope AL employers will only hire entry level employees that have earned a degree from an accredited school.
Does the School Ready You for Certification? Certification is not mandated in every state, but numerous pharmacies prefer that the technicians they employ are certified. The pharmacist tech school needs to ready its students to pass the PTCB or the NHA examination. Students interested in obtaining NHA certification will also need 1 year of job experience. This qualification can be satisfied by entering a college sponsored internship program.
Does the College Sponsor Internship Programs? As we just covered, the NHA requires a year of professional experience for certification, which can be satisfied through an internship program. Perhaps the best way to get hands on clinical experience as a pharmacy technician is to work out in the field. Most pharmacy technician certificate or degree programs also require practical training in order to graduate and an internship is a great way to fulfill the requirement. Ask if the colleges have a working relationship with Fairhope Alabama area pharmacies, hospitals, or clinics for internship programs.
Does the School Provide Job Placement Help? Securing that initial job in Fairhope AL after graduation, especially with no experience, can be a daunting endeavor without some help. Ask if the colleges you are reviewing have job placement programs. If they do, ask what their job placement rates are. A higher job placement rate is an indication that the school has an excellent reputation within the field creating demand for its graduates. It also signifies that it has a sizable network of pharmacy relationships where it can place graduates.
Where is the Program Located? For a lot of students, the school they decide on will need to be within commuting distance of their Fairhope AL home. Individuals who have decided to attend classes online obviously will not have to worry themselves with the location of the campus. However, the availability of area internships will be of importance. One thing to consider is that if you choose to enroll in a college that is out of state or even out of your local area, you may have to pay a higher tuition. State colleges commonly charge higher tuitions for out of state residents. And community colleges typically charge a higher tuition for those students that live outside of their districts.
How Big are the Classes ? Unless you are the kind of person that prefers to sit way in the rear of class or get lost in the crowd, you will probably want a small class size. Smaller classes enable more individual participation and personalized instruction. Ask the schools you are considering what the average teacher to student ratio is for their classrooms. If practical you may want to monitor one or more classes before making your ultimate decision. This will also give you an opportunity to talk with a few of the students and instructors to get their perspectives regarding the pharmacist technician program as well.
Can the Program Accommodate your Schedule? And last you must verify that the pharmacy technician school you ultimately select can offer the class schedule you need. This is especially important if you opt to continue working while you attend school. If you need to schedule evening or weekend classes in the Fairhope AL area, confirm that they are available. If you can only attend part-time, check if that is an alternative and how many credit hours or courses you would need to carry. Also, learn what the procedure is for making up any classes that you might miss due to illness, work or family obligations.
